The vote clears the way for another Senate vote on the estate tax, following the Senate's rejection of repeal earlier this month.
An ad advocating the tax features Paris Hilton as a likely beneficiary of the repeal. The media and lobbying efforts are strongest in states represented by senators whose votes will determine the outcome. They include Democrats such as Louisiana's Mary Landrieu, Oregon's Ron Wyden, Montana's Max Baucus and Indiana's Evan Bayh, as well as Republicans such as Arizona's John McCain and Ohio's George Voinovich.
